What they do

Donate Funds to Bethesda Hospital, Inc. A 501(c)3 Tax-exempt Organization, Grant Health Career Scholarships to Students Pursuing Health Careers to Beneficiaries Who Are In No Way Related to or Financially Connected to or Dependent On Any Auxiliary Members or Officers.
